Chteau De La Gardine Gaston Philippe Chteauneuf-Du-Pape Cuve Des Gnrations 750 ml
The winemaking tradition of the Brunel family dates back to the 17th century. Gaston Brunel, a famous negociant, acquired the Chateau de la Gardine in Chateauneuf du Pape in 1945. The estate is now run by his two sons, Patrick and Maxime with the help of their wives Eve and Maryse and their children Marie-Odile and Philippe. The estate spreads over 52 ha of vineyards (48 ha of red and 4 ha of white) and 20 ha of forests, all gathered around the property. The domaine is famous for the quality of their wines and for the unique Gardine bottle. Today around 70% of the production is exported in about 30 countries. In 1998, feeling the potential of the Lirac terroir, they also bought the Chateau Saint Roch in Roquemaure (40 ha), where a selection of red, white, and rose wines is produced. It is Eve Brunel, who is also the oenologist for both La Gardine and St Roch, who runs the estate. Robert Parker says: ?Not to be overlooked is the Brunel family?s Chateau Saint Roch estate in Lirac, from which some terrific bargains emerge.? Today the Brunel family comes back to the negoce tradition in the family with ?Brunel de le Gardine?, allowing them to offer a wide range of both Southern and Northern Rhone appellations. Patrick Brunel chooses the best wines from each appellation using trustful relations with top winegrowers in the area. The family then uses all their knowledge and experience blending and maturing the wines, respecting tradition and the typicity of each terroir. The quality packaging, with the Gardine special bottle, is the signature of this fine selection.
